Claims
- 1. A draw latch for latching together two closure members, said draw latch having an open and a closed position, said draw latch comprising:
- a. a keeper for securing to one of the closure members;
- b. a base bracket for attaching to the other of the closure members;
- c. a housing having a first end and a second end, the first end of the housing pivotally and detachably connected to the keeper;
- d. a clevis having a first and a second end, the first end of the clevis pivotally secured to the base bracket, and the second end of the clevis pivotally secured to the second end of the housing; and
- e. said housing having a vertical slot having a narrowed portion matable to said clevis, said acting as a detent such that said clevis snaps into place in said slot to retain said draw latch in its open position.
